Creating the Button component

Create the following ~/snapterest/source/components/Button.js file:

import React from 'react';

const buttonStyle = {
  margin: '10px 0'
};

const Button = ({ label, handleClick }) => (
  <button
    className="btn btn-default"
    style={buttonStyle}
    onClick={handleClick}
  >
    {label}
  </button>
);

export default Button;

The Button component renders a button.

Notice that we didn't declare a class, but rather defined a simple function called Button. This is the functional way of creating React components. In fact, when the purpose of your component is purely to render some user interface elements with or without any props, then it's recommended that you use this approach.
